Autor Zpráva
Fisir
Profil
Ahoj, řeším následující problém:
Mám tabulku a, ve které mám sloupec id, amount, description a timestamp. V tabulce b jsou ty samé sloupce, jen je přidán sloupec active. Sloupce id mají pouze v oné tabulce unikátní hodnotu.

Nyní potřebuji spojit tyto dvě tabulky, tak, aby se nijak neměnily záznamy, jen aby se seřadily podle sloupce timestamp. Je to vůbec možné?
DJ Miky
Profil
UNION ALL? Jenom budeš muset sloupec active z tabulky b vynechat nebo v části dotazu u tabulky a doplnit za sloupec nějakou zástupnou hodnotu (např. null).

Nicméně pokud se nejedná o jednorázový dotaz, bylo by dobré pouvažovat o změně struktury databáze (sloučení do jedné tabulky).
Fisir
Profil
Reaguji na DJ Mikyho:
Díky.

Nejedná se o jednorázový dotaz, ale slučovat tabulky je podle mého názoru nevhodné, jsou v nich rozdílná data, časem možná přibydou další odlišnosti.
Toto vlákno je staré, již dlouho do něj nikdo nepřispíval.

Informace a odkazy zde uváděné už nemusejí být aktuální. Nechcete-li řešit zde uvedenou konkrétní otázku, založte si vlastní vlákno, nepište do tohoto. Vložíte-li sem nyní příspěvek, upoutáte pozornost mnoha lidí a někteří z nich si jen kvůli vám přečtou i všechny předcházející příspěvky. Předpokládáte-li, že váš text skutečně bude hodnotný, stiskněte následující tlačítko:


Běda vám, jestli to bude blábol.

0